Abstract
This study explores the application of artificial intelligence (AI) in the context of Human Resource Management (HRM), specifically within Talent Acquisition Procedures (TAP).In contrast to prior research, it contributes a significant theoretical model to elucidate the effective implementation of AI in TAP.The study focuses on the underexplored impact of the recruitment phase, incorporating the critical perspective of recruitment professionals.It extends technology adoption theory within information systems by integrating insights from HRM literature.Qualitative findings from this study reveal the suitability of AI in specific TAP phases, such as sourcing, pre-screening/pre-selection, and candidate engagement.Notably, there is a discernible reluctance to adopt AI in the TAP pre-planning and interview stages.The study provides current insights to inform HRM practitioners and organizations seeking to integrate AI into their Talent Acquisition Procedures.
